Elgin IL1565 Fleetwood DriveElgin, IL 60123, USACombined Metals
is a premier North American processor and distributor of specialty
strip and wire built through 50 years of growth and acquisition.
Combined Metals is the largest independent processor and
distributor of specialty strip and wire in North America. With nine
service centers, Combined Metals supports over 3,000 customers in
the Aerospace, Defense, Nuclear, Medical, Petrochemical, Oil & Gas,
Electrification, Automotive, and Consumer industries. Decades of
quality and reliability have made Combined Metals a chosen source
in performance applications.Responsibilities:
